Basketball: “We will have to see if we are able to do that when it will challenge more”, launches Collet after the demonstration against Tunisia

Vincent Collet (coach of the French basketball team, after the 93-36 victory against Tunisia): "We knew it wasn't even Tunisia... normal, let's say, there were a lot of young people, they were weakened, it's a bit of a shame. But in the positive points to remember, we really shared the ball, made an effort. Since the beginning (of the rally), we have insisted a lot on playing behind the picks, in order to favor the movement of the ball which we had not managed to find last year, except on rare occasions. There has already been a real effort to share. Now we must continue. We must not stop at this game. It will already be more complicated on Wednesday. And little by little, the adversity will mount. During this time, we have to progress day by day. Faced with more adversity, we will have to continue to play relatively fair. In the first period, we had a lot of baskets after passes, less in one against one, the ball circulated well and we found solutions. We will have to see if we are able to do that when it becomes more challenging. We'll see. It will be necessary to work to improve the timings, that the players go faster on the markdowns. We'll see if we can do that against a stronger opponent." (on beIN SPORTS)

Rudy Gobert (pivot of the France team): "We wanted to take the right habits, regardless of the opponent, regardless of the stage of preparation, that's our objective. I'm very happy with what we did tonight. The preparation will be short, so every minute counts, every quarter. We will continue to grow. (on his hesitation to come in Blue this summer) When I'm there, I'm there (smile). I'm never halfway there!" (on France 4)

Nando de Colo (French team leader): "We knew it wasn't necessarily their best team or the biggest warm-up game we could have had, with all due respect to them , but we had to be focused on what we had to do and put into practice what we have worked on since the beginning of the preparation. It's important to use everything, training, matches, video sessions, those where we are among ourselves. We have to communicate as much as possible, find automatisms in order to be ready from the first match and be the best team possible at the World Cup. Are automatisms coming back fast two years after the Games? Yes of course. I'm not new to the team (smile), so the automatisms are found quite quickly. It's always a pleasure to wear the blue jersey and to be with the group. Sylvain Francisco and Yakuba Ouattara? It's good to have generations coming. We know that you need a core and players around who can integrate. They are there to learn, they are in demand but they will contribute, that's for sure. (on France 4)
